Siân Heder has won the best adapted screenplay Oscar for her content for “CODA.” It’s the main Oscar for Heder, who adjusted the content from the 2014 French film “La Famille Bélier.”

Heder additionally produced the little transitioning film about the main hearing part in a group of hard-of-hearing grown-ups.

It’s additionally selected for best picture. For adapted screenplay, “CODA” beat down “The Power of the Dog,” “The Lost Daughter,” “Ridge” and “Drive My Car.”



Prior, Troy Kotsur has won the best-supporting entertainer Oscar for his role in “CODA.”

Kotsur turned into the second entertainer who is hard of hearing to win an Academy Award. His “CODA” co-star Marlee Matlin was the principal when she won the best actor for “Offspring of a Lesser God” in 1987.

Who Is Siân Heder?

Sian Heder is an American writer and filmmaker. Heder moved to Hollywood to turn into an entertainer and screenwriter while working for a babysitter organization.

At the office, she worked for visitors with youngsters remaining at four-star lodgings and her encounters motivated her first short film.

In mid-2005, the content for Mother was 1 of 8 decided to be granted an association for the esteemed American Film Institute’s DWW (Directing Workshop for Women).
